Psychologically, gambling is designed to be addictive. Winning triggers the Mind’s reward technique, releasing dopamine and developing a euphoric rush. The "close to-miss" effect—exactly where a player Virtually wins—further more fuels the belief that a major gain is simply around the corner. Quite a few gamblers also drop in to the behavior of "chasing losses," believing they're able to Get well lost funds with yet one more wager. This risky cycle can lead to major monetary effects, strained associations, and mental medical issues for example stress and anxiety and melancholy.
